While working out on a treadmill indoors is not renowned for being the most exciting of exercises, using a good quality treadmill has a number of benefits over running outside. The British climate is not the best condition to be running in, slippery roads could lead to injury, whilst the cold windy air can affect your breathing and overall performance. Working out on a treadmill provides you with a flat running surface and the more advanced treadmills have sophisticated shock absorbent systems to reduce the impact suffered by the body. Keeping yourself entertained while working out on the treadmill helps to take your mind off of what you are actually doing, helping you to increase the time spent on the treadmill. So position your treadmill in front of a TV or play your favourite album to get the most out of the time spent working out.
Most treadmills come with a variety of different workout programmes. Making the most of these programs will help to increase your fitness levels over a shorter period of time than just jumping on the treadmill and using the manual settings. It is important when purchasing a treadmill to ensure it has a number of heart rate interactive programs. HR programs ensure you get the most out of your treadmill by keeping you within the correct HR zone.
If you are training for an outdoor event, using the treadmills incline can help to replicate running uphill or against a strong wind. And don't forget to try out our Treadmill Challenge.
